1 - Mashed Potatoes

mashed potatoes Save for Later!

Let's start with the basics. Mashed potatoes are a staple in almost all American homes.

This easy-to-make and quick side dish goes best with vegetable and meat dishes - or try mashed cauliflower side ideas for a lighter twist.

And since cabbage rolls are mostly meat stuffed in a veggie leaf, it means cabbage rolls and mashed potatoes are a match made in heaven.

The creamy, buttery, and smooth texture of mashed potatoes go with the flavor of cabbage rolls and their stuffing.

To spice things up, you can even add extra butter, cream, spices, or even bits of onions and cabbage into your mashed potatoes.

2 - Tomato Soup

tomato soup Save for Later!

Do you prefer soups on the side? Well, you can try the classic tomato soup with your cabbage rolls.

It's sweet with a little bit of tartness and overall delicious.

Tomato soup as a side dish works wonders if your cabbage roll is stuffed with fatty meat - pair it following tomato soup side pairings for balanced flavors.

The tangy flavor of the soup will balance out the fatty flavor.

Tomato soup is also one of the healthiest side dishes out there.

It is packed with vitamin C and antioxidants that boost immunity, heart, and skin health.

Just remember to keep your tomato soup's texture on the thin to mildly-thick side, and you're good to go.

6 - Garlic Roasted Carrots

garlic roasted carrots Save for Later!

Are your cabbage rolls mostly filled with rice and meat? Then you'll love some garlic roasted carrots on the side.

We're talking fresh baby carrots roasted with garlic, pepper, balsamic vinegar, salt, and spices.

Add some thyme for an extra burst of flavor.

And there you have it - a tempting, sizzling plate of garlic roasted carrots.

All the ingredients blend well to create a nice side dish that goes well with the intense mouthful flavor of stuffed cabbage rolls.

Also, carrots are also rich in fiber, vitamins, antioxidants, and potassium - all the more reason to serve it as a healthy side dish.

7 - Rye Bread

rye bread Save for Later!

Suppose it's one of those days when you're extremely hungry.

Then you can pair your cabbage rolls with some delicious rye bread and enjoy a filling meal.

Trust us, slices of rye bread and cabbage rolls do look great on a plate together.

They're appealing to the eyes as much as they're satisfying to your palate.

To enhance its flavor, you can add some caraway seeds to your rye bread.
